Claude Kriescher has a diverse work experience. Claude started in 1994 as the CEO of Steel Elec SA, a company specializing in the distribution of electrical materials. In 2014, they took on the role of President of the CCATM-CLDR Commune de Hamoir and also became Vice-Président Régie Communale Hamoir - RCA. In 2016, they became an Administrator and Vice-President at the Office du Tourisme de Hamoir. In 2018, they became the Financial Director of the Volley Belgium Federation. Lastly, in 2020, they became the Vice-President of the WEVZA Zonal association for the Confederation Européenne de Volleyball (CEV).

Claude Kriescher completed a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.) degree at Sainte Marie - Liège from 1989 to 1991. There is no information provided about additional education at HELMO Liège.

The European Volleyball Confederation (CEV) is the FIVB supporting institution responsible for governing 56 National Federations throughout Europe and is recognized as such by the Fédération Internationale de Volleyball (FIVB). The CEV has the authority and responsibility for organizing all European competitions in Volleyball and Beach Volleyball. The CEV headquarters are located in Luxembourg City (Grand Duchy of Luxembourg). The CEV shall pursue, in the geographical area that is placed under its authority, the aims of the FIVB to encourage the development and growth of Volleyball and Beach Volleyball in all its forms as set out in the FIVB Constitution, with particular emphasis on: • Coordinating the activity of the National Federations, to promote their mutual cooperation and understanding and settling any disputes. • Fostering the development of friendly relations between the National Federations and all officials, trainers, referees and players. • Ensuring adherence to the FIVB Constitution, Code of Conduct, Regulations, Official Rules and any other FIVB decision. • Promoting the expansion and popularity of Volleyball and Beach Volleyball in all their forms. • Encouraging the establishment of National Federations and their membership in the FIVB. • Organizing Continental Championships and all other official competitions. • Encouraging the organization of courses and advanced training sessions in both technical subjects and refereeing.
